A trip, including hotel and air, is prices at $319.19 after tax. If the tax rate is 12%, calculate the price before tax that will result in this tax-included amount

Answers

Answer: $285

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

A trip costs [tex]\$319.19[/tex] after-tax inclusion

The rate of tax is 12%

Suppose x is the amount of charge before tax inclusion

We can write

[tex]\Rightarrow x+12\%x=319.19\\\Rightarrow x(1+0.12)=319.19\\\\\Rightarrow x=\dfrac{319.19}{1.12}\\\\\Rightarrow x=\$284.99\approx \$285[/tex]

The amount before tax inclusion is $285

Find the fifth term when a1=4 and r=-3

Answers

Answer:

a₅ = 324

Step-by-step explanation:

The nth term of a geometric sequence is

[tex]a_{n}[/tex] = a₁ [tex]r^{n-1}[/tex] then

a₅ = 4 × [tex](-3)^{4}[/tex] = 4 × 81 = 324

Twice a number plus 6 times the number is 72

Answers

Answer:

9

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the no be x

By the conditions given ,

2x + 6x = 72

8x = 72

x = 72/8

x = 9

therefore the no is 9
